 
					 
					
	Stone costed roofing tile is a new type of roofing material that uses aluminum-zinc coated steel sheets as the base material, with a surface covered in sintered colored stone sand. It features aesthetic appeal, durability, and environmental friendliness. Below are its main characteristics and advantages:
	
	
	Base material layer: Galvanized aluminum steel plate, with anti-rust performance 3-6 times stronger than ordinary steel plate.
	Surface Layer: Colored sand made from high-temperature firing of basalt minerals, featuring long-lasting colors and soundproofing and sun protection properties.
	Protective layer: Acrylic resin coating, enhancing impact resistance and weather resistance.
	
	
	Durability: Lifespan of 30-50 years, resistant to wind (up to 12-level gusts), fireproof (made of non-combustible materials), and corrosion-resistant.
	Lightweight: Weighing only 4-7 kilograms per square meter, it is 40% lighter than traditional tiles, making it ideal for renovating old houses.
	Easy installation: The large single-piece area increases installation efficiency by 60% compared to traditional tiles.
	
	
	It is 100% recyclable, with production energy consumption over 60% lower than traditional tiles, reducing resource waste.

	High-end residential villas: High aesthetic appeal with a variety of colors and designs to choose from.
	Multi-disaster-prone areas: such as regions frequently affected by typhoons and earthquakes, due to their strong wind and earthquake resistance capabilities.
	Old House Renovation: Can be directly installed, saving construction costs.
	
	
	Soundproofing and Thermal Insulation: Noise levels during rainy days are 3-5 decibels higher than those of concrete tiles, so it is recommended to add an insulation layer.
Construction Requirements: The nail spacing must be controlled (300-400 mm), and the cut edges require anti-corrosion treatment.
